Years ago S&W had a replacement back strap that could be ordered from them. Easy to install and the grip feels like that of the 1911A1. I don't know if they are still available or not but maybe an email to S&W might get you the answer. It was never widely known and I would not have know about it if a factory rep hadn't informed me about it and sent me one to try. This was just after they came out with the 659 model and that was quite awhile ago.
